Senior Technical Associate - .NET Fullstack
Date: Dec 4, 2025
Location: Hyderabad, India
Company: Evoke Technologies Private Limited
Job Summary
The Senior Technical Associate under direct supervision of the Technical Lead / Project Manager is responsible for developing, implementing and supporting individual components within an application. This involves analysis, developing/coding, testing and implementation of the components. This may also involve providing enhancements and ongoing application support to the deployed application.
Experience
Location: Hyderabad
Work Mode : Hybrid (2 days/week)
Experience: 9 to 14 Years
Employment Type: Full-time
Job Requirement:
- Experience in building scalable, modular applications using C# and .NET Core
- Familiarity with MediatR pattern.
- Experience integrating resilience patterns (e.g., Polly) and advanced exception handling.
- Proficient in at least one modern front-end framework (e.g., Blazor, React, Angular, Vue).
- Familiarity with Fluxor or any other state management pattern (e.g., Redux).
- Strong understanding of data modeling, migrations, LINQ queries, and performance optimization using Entity Framework Core.
- Familiarity with Clean Architecture and modular design principles.
- Knowledge of cloud platforms, particularly Azure, for Cloud native development, deploying and managing applications.
- Experience on Agile methodology and Test methodologies
- Ability to translate complex business requirements into maintainable, scalable solutions.
- Excellent communication skills to handle any issue, requirement discussion, daily stand-up call with client.
Key Responsibilities
- Expertise in C#, .Net Core, React
- Comfortable with using work management through Azure DevOps
- Familiar with logging tools such as Application Insights, Dynatrace.
- Expertise with Microsoft products and services
- Experience implementing DevOps practices
Competencies